I understand that studying this much in 5 minutes of studying can be overwhelming, however you don’t must memorize every thing instantly. Our SQL Cheat Sheet lays out these instructions in a easy, easy-to-reference format, so you probably can quickly lookup what you need. Seize it and start working towards – you’ll be writing queries like a professional in no time. It helps you find, filter, and organize information in seconds as a substitute of manually searching by way of endless spreadsheets. If you’re just getting began, mastering a quantity of key SQL instructions provides you with a solid basis.

Beekeeper Studio helps multiple databases including SQL Server, MySQL, PostgreSQL, SQLite, and extra. Though SQL follows a standard normal, completely different database techniques have slight variations, known as dialects. Ensuring knowledge integrity is a critical step in maintaining high-quality data. You should implement data integrity at all levels of an utility from first entry or collection via storage.

Don’t Cease Learning And Training Sql

Not Like SSMS, it’s cross-platform and constructed on the same framework as Visible Studio Code, giving it a well-recognized interface for a lot of builders. Temporal tables retailer the complete historical past of adjustments to rows in a SQL Server table, and EF Core now fully helps working with them. The first snippet reveals tips on how to enable temporal assist in your entity mapping.

Its plugin structure permits for appreciable customization and extension of functionality. Whereas HeidiSQL is Windows-only like SSMS, it deserves point out for its lightweight nature and excellent SQL Server support. Originally designed for MySQL, HeidiSQL has expanded to assist SQL Server, PostgreSQL, and MariaDB with a clear, efficient interface. These safety greatest practices are important for safeguarding database purposes. Using parameterized queries protects in opposition to SQL injection, whereas connection pooling ensures efficient use of database connections. Centralized encryption methods with companies like Azure Key Vault cut back the danger of delicate data exposure.

You can earn a digital achievement badge for successfully finishing this certificates program, as properly as a separate badge for each course. If English just isn’t your native language, you should have at least Mobile app development intermediate English expertise to enroll. To see if you qualify, make certain you are at the B2 level on the CEFR self-assessment grid. To learn more, see English Language Proficiency Necessities – Noncredit Programs. In this module, we’ll walk through the installation process of SQL Server Specific on Windows, Mac, and Linux platforms. By the tip, you may have your environment set up and ready for growth.

Think of SQL as a means of getting a conversation together with your database – asking questions and getting specific solutions in return. It lets you insert, update, delete, and retrieve information with precision and efficiency. This accessibility makes SQL easier to be taught in comparability with many different programming languages. This identical precept helps businesses monitor buyer purchases, manage inventory, and analyze gross sales patterns – all whereas maintaining information consistent and accessible. In select learning packages, you’ll be able to apply for monetary help or a scholarship if you can’t afford the enrollment fee. If fin assist or scholarship is out there on your learning program choice, you’ll discover a hyperlink to use on the outline page.

The extension marketplace for Azure Knowledge Studio lets you add functionality as needed, together with schema comparability instruments, SQL Server dashboard widgets, and query execution plans. EF Core introduces native support for LeftJoin, simplifying complex joins. Working with your individual database allows you to experiment freely, make errors, and learn from them without any exterior consequences, thereby constructing confidence and proficiency in SQL. Right Here is a tutorial for you on how to Create Your Personal Database to Apply SQL. While these dialects have slightly totally different features, they all observe the same basic ideas of ordinary SQL.

microsoft sql database development

This module introduces tips on how to use the set operators UNION, INTERSECT, and EXCEPT to match rows between two input units. This module introduces the fundamentals of the SELECT statement, specializing in queries against a single table. If you’re on the lookout for alternatives that are free, open source, and probably cross-platform, listed here are five wonderful choices for 2025.

Interceptors enable developers to hook into the EF Core question lifecycle, giving them the ability to log, modify, or monitor SQL commands before they’re executed. This is beneficial for diagnostics, debugging, efficiency logging, and even enforcing application-level guidelines across all queries in a central place. In the example, collection expressions simplify how arrays or lists are created and used immediately in LINQ queries. This makes the code more concise and simpler to learn when filtering results against a predefined record of values.

Packt helps tech professionals put software to work by distilling and sharing the working knowledge of their friends. You May learn to create user logins, add Windows-authenticated logins, and manage entry to your server utilizing safe strategies. This module seems at the way to measure and monitor the efficiency of your SQL Server databases. The first two classes take a glance at SQL Server Extended Occasions, a versatile, light-weight event-handling system constructed into the Microsoft SQL Server Database Engine. These lessons give attention to the architectural ideas, troubleshooting methods and usage situations. This module describes the design and implementation of saved procedures.

Module 2: Designing And Implementing Tables

You’ll use different methods to handle databases efficiently, serving to you get hands-on experience with SQL Server. In this module, we are going to discover key instruments used to interact with SQL Server, including SQL Server Administration Studio and Azure Information Studio. You Will additionally learn how to visualize your database structures utilizing Draw.io.

microsoft sql database development

  • In Microsoft SQL Server information management software program tables are contained within schemas which are very comparable in concept to folders that contain recordsdata within the operating system.
  • What makes databases so powerful and efficient is their structure, which is predicated on relationships between tables that retailer associated information.
  • This module describes tips on how to return outcomes by executing saved procedures.
  • By exploring SQL Server Management Studio and Azure Information Studio, you’ll gain familiarity with the essential tools for database management.
  • By linking college students to their enrolled topics, the database maintains organization with out duplicating data.

By understanding these fundamentals of SQL and relational databases, you are taking the first step toward mastering some of the useful expertise in at present’s data-driven world. Whether Or Not you are analyzing buyer conduct, managing stock, or monitoring student performance, SQL supplies the instruments you want to become a data native speaker. This SQL a hundred and one is designed to make your studying smooth, providing clear explanations and sensible examples that can assist you construct a stable microsoft sql server development services foundation in SQL. This module explains the means to name, declare, assign values to, and use variables. Concurrency control is a crucial characteristic of multiuser database systems; it allows information to stay constant when many customers are modifying information at the similar time.

You must buy the course to access content material not included within the preview. This module describes tips on how to enhance your T-SQL code with programming parts. This module describes a quantity of types of subquery and the way and when to use them. This module introduces some of the many inbuilt capabilities in SQL Server. This module describes how to create DML queries, and why you’d wish to.